Some gasoline filters are hard to find and may be in ...If your lawnmower won't shut off, it could have a faulty ignition switch. The ignition switch actually works in the opposite way that you might think it would. When the engine is running, the switch is in the off position. When you want to stop the engine, the switch is turned on, creating a path to ground. Messages. 24,705. Apr 22, 2019 / Z425 2007 year model mower keeps shutting off when i engage the pto. #3. Start the engine, set the parking brake & get off the seat. If the engine stops the seat switch is faulty or the wires to the seat switch are shorting to the frame. The safety circuit is a ground circuit so if it shorts to ground there ...This is when the lawnmower engine is off and yet the electrical system drains the battery. How To Test. It's a deadman switch, if it loses contact for even a second, the mower will die. The switch connections are not well protected from the elements, and prone to dust, corrosion, etc. You need: Remove the connections of the deadman safety switch. Clean the spades with the wire brush. Then slather the spades with dielectric grease.

A fuel line that is clogged can also cause a lawnmower to cut out. The fuel line carries the gas from the fuel tank and delivers it to the engine. Rethink Robotics, a Boston-based industrial robotics company that aimed to make factory workers more ef...Instagram:https://instagram. sanibel mucky duckboggle answers 4x4nearest costco gasolinehow old is sean hannity and ainsley earhardt If the mower keeps shutting off when you cut thick areas of grass, make sure the mower height is not set too low. Many mowers have wheel levers at each of the mower's four wheels, or another way to adjust the mower height. Stop the mower engine, raise the height and resume mowing.
